@nmashton This is usually defined in the bylaws, and can be up to the group.

I'd say the most common approach is the require folks the join the #coop at the end of their trial period, but to empower the board of directors to make exceptions on a case-by-case basis. I do also know #coops for whom, at the end of the probationary period the choice is join or leave.

It ties heavily into how ownership fits into the company culture. #workercoop #workerstoowners #coopconversion
